Welcome to my kitchen!

As you’ve probably guessed, I’m Erika.  Food has been a huge part of my life since birth.  Well, maybe not since birth but shortly thereafter.

I grew up with a mother who loved to cook and entertain.  I remember being 5 years old on a step stool at the kitchen counter helping her make hundreds of appetizers in preparation for dinner and cocktail parties.  By 6 years old I had already mastered deviled eggs, bacon wrapped meatballs and stuffed cherry tomatoes.  As much as I loved helping with these dinners and parties, my fondest memories are of the meals my mother prepared just for me, my favorite foods she put so much care and love into making.

Since that time, food has become an extension of who I am and it’s how I express myself.  Whether it’s a simple sandwich, a batch of cookies or a five-course meal, everything you eat should be special in some way.  It just tastes better!

With that being said, my relationship with food has definitely had ups and downs.  I used it as a crutch and band-aid for issues, as much as I used it for good.  Now it has changed for the better and I’ve found a happy medium between splurging and living a healthy lifestyle.  As of today I’m proud to say I’ve lost 60 lbs. and have maintained that loss for a year now.  I still have a bit to go to be where I’d like to be, but I’ve learned we’re all a work in progress and it’s okay to take it one day at a time.

Six years ago I met the most amazing man who, lucky for me, likes food almost as much as I do.  I’ve always enjoyed cooking for my friends and family, and now there’s a whole new joy to cooking, for and beside my husband.  After six years of cooking, trying hundreds of restaurants, talking about food endlessly and not letting him eat anything until I can snap a picture, he finally convinced me to start a blog.

Although I eat healthy a majority of the time I still manage to indulge in more sinful things.  My intention with this blog is to lighten up some recipes while keeping true to my favorite dishes.  I believe in healthy eating but I also believe in butter, red meat and real cheese, especially cheese.

I work full-time and I’m lucky enough to really love my job.  Of course my 9 to 5 takes up quite a bit of my week, however, I find plenty of time to cook and discover new food.  I’m so happy to share my adventures with all of you and I hope you enjoy!

Just remember, food should always be made with love.
